Property description

"open house event" - saturday 19th may - Please call for your individual appointment to view. Situated on one of Harrow on the Hill's most favoured gated Private Roads and within a Conservation Area, this delightful 5 bedroom, 2 bathroom detached house was skilfully designed to take full advantage of the large well-tended plot and Southerly aspect to the rear. Strongly influenced by the "Arts & Crafts" style of architecture, all the principal rooms enjoy a garden aspect with plenty of natural light and from upstairs a wonderful view of the fields and woodland beyond. Very well presented throughout, the accommodation includes a splendid lounge with open fireplace, separate dining room, study, 21' (6.4m) kitchen/breakfast room and contemporary-style conservatory. There are also traditional leaded windows and exposed timber beams plus the benefits of gas-fired central heating, a deep and wide frontage and a garage with driveway parking.

The property is ideally situated for family life being just a short walk from Orley Farm Preparatory School for Boys and Girls and with many other private, church and state schools close by as well as delightful open spaces, golf courses and leisure facilities to visit locally. London is easily accessible from a number of Metropolitan, Piccadilly and Main Line stations in the area and there are also excellent road links to the motorway network and London airports.

This property offers generous space with great charm, character and delightful gardens and may also offer potential to extend (subject to consent) as it stands well within a large plot. We highly recommend an early inspection.
